H3: Installation Recommendations
Look at compatibility: Guarantee your laser engraver's controller and electrical power source can guidance the infrared module. Most 12V or 24V diode laser controllers function. Check out the module's voltage and recent necessities. Get rid of your existing laser module: Unplug your latest blue laser module from your controller and power supply. Mount the Alpha MK2: Connect the infrared module to the laser engraver's gantry using the provided mounting brackets. Make sure it is actually stage and protected.Join wiring: Link the module's PWM signal and energy wires for your controller and electric power provide. Follow the wiring diagram furnished by AlgoLaser. Established target: Use the main focus Instrument or measure the right distance within the laser lens to the material area (ordinarily all around forty-60mm depending upon the module). Exam on scrap content: Just before engraving your remaining piece, check with a scrap piece of the identical material to dial in energy and velocity options.
If You aren't snug with wiring, request a skilled Good friend or local maker Room for help. Improper installation can hurt the module or your engraver.
H3: Compatible Materials with the AlgoLaser 1064nm Infrared Module
The
Metals (immediate marking): Chrome steel, aluminum, brass, titanium, copper, nickel, and several alloys. Anodized aluminum: Gets rid of the anodized layer to expose bare aluminum (white/silver mark). Darkish plastics: ABS, polycarbonate, plus some engineering plastics. Coated metals: Powder-coated or painted metals (gets rid of coating to expose bare metallic). - Wood and leather: Can engrave, but blue lasers will often be extra efficient for these components.
Stone and glass: Minimal success; best with CO2 or blue diode lasers.
Not all metals mark equally. Stainless-steel provides the top high-contrast darkish marks. Aluminum might generate a lighter grey mark. Brass and copper develop dark marks but may possibly have to have many passes. Often examination 1st.
H3: Suggested Options for Prevalent Elements
Options fluctuate determined by your precise laser energy (watts) and content. Begin with these standard rules and modify:
Chrome steel (dim mark): eighty-100% electric power, 500-a thousand mm/min velocity, 1 go. Aluminum (gentle mark): 70-90% electrical power, 800-1500 mm/min speed, 1-2 passes. Brass (dark mark): ninety-100% energy, four hundred-800 mm/min velocity, 1-two passes.- Anodized aluminum (white mark): 30-fifty% ability, one thousand-2000 mm/min velocity, one move.
Darkish plastic: 20-40% electrical power, five hundred-one thousand mm/min velocity, 1 pass (watch out to not melt).

H4: Security Safeguards for 1064nm Infrared Lasers
The AlgoLaser 1064nm Infrared Laser Module Alpha MK2 emits invisible laser radiation. This is more risky than noticeable lasers because you can not begin to see the beam. Eye damage can occur instantly with no warning. Adhere to these protection policies:
- Use a fully enclosed laser engraver with interlocks. Never run the laser without the enclosure shut.
Don certified 1064nm laser basic safety Eyeglasses. Typical sunglasses or blue laser Eyeglasses is not going to safeguard you. Buy glasses exclusively rated for 1064nm wavelength with OD6+ protection. - Do not search straight at the laser or reflections. Shiny steel surfaces can reflect the beam. Make use of a matte surface area or assure reflections are contained.
Set up a laser curtain or protect. In case your engraver is not really totally enclosed, include Bodily obstacles within the do the job region. Submit warning symptoms. Notify Many others that an invisible laser is in use. Maintain unauthorized people absent. Never go away the laser unattended although operating. Fires can begin Despite metal engraving (debris can ignite).
Protection is non-negotiable. Infrared lasers are strong equipment. Respect them.

H3: Could be the 1064nm beam obvious?
No. The 1064nm wavelength is inside the infrared spectrum, fully invisible into the human eye. This can be risky since you cannot see the beam. You will need to use a totally enclosed laser engraver and use Qualified 1064nm laser protection Eyeglasses always. Usually do not rely upon the crimson guideline laser (if Outfitted) for safety; the actual reducing beam is invisible. United states of america end users will have to follow rigid security protocols.
